List of all NFL Players Born on January 20

(See today's birthdays)

Birthdays

Birthdays Table
Passing Rushing Receiving
Rk Player Pos Born From To AP1 PB St wAV G Cmp Att Yds TD Lng Int Sk Yds Att Yds TD Lng Rec Yds TD Lng
1Al AfalavaDB198720092012001529000
2Braelon AllenRB20042024202400001307828322016135115
3Bob BellingerG191319341935001018000
4Buddy BurrisG-LB192319491951002029000
5Joe CannavinoDB1935196019620031532000
6Ron CarpenterDB197019931999000345000
7Rae CarruthWR19741997199900182207270662804452
8Alcides CatanhoLB197219951996000227000
9Red ChenowethWB-TB18991921192100101000
10Nakia CodieDB19772000200000016000
11Emanuel CookDB198820102011000017000
12Jim DeLisleDT19491971197100039000
13Emari DemercadoRB19992023202400032708250735337223024
14Darnell DinkinsTE1977200220090001890030250422
15Gary DulinDE-DT19571986198700026000
16Perry Lee DunnRB194119641969002774163213220021465361542408143
17Terrell EdmundsS19972018202400527101000
18James FinneganE-QB19011923192300002000
19Nick FolesQB19892012202201332711302208714227828347127875151407621110015
20Aldo ForteG-T191819391947020049000
21Jack FreemanG192219461946000012000
22Bob GaddisWR19521976197600002000
23Chris GannonDE-TE196619891993000540010000
24Tony GarbarczykDE19641987198700002000
25Frank GiddensT195919811982000525000
26Ray HamiltonNT-DE19511973198100846132000
27Ken HamlinDB19812003201001637107000
28Cortez HanktonWR1981200320060003460034310222
29Eli HaroldOLB1994201520180021161000
30Jim HigginsT-G19421966196600027000
31Ali HighsmithLB198520082009000220000
32Tory HumphreyTE1983200520100012310013181037
33Stefan HumphriesG196219841988001733000
34Eddie HunterRB1965198719870002605621002372828
35J.J. JansenC19862009202401021256000
36Cullen JenkinsDT19812004201600952184000
37Chuck KasselE190319271933006079022091857
38Duce KeaheyT19171942194200002000
39Bill KenneyQB195519801988017501061330243017277105848619514871231915212000
40Eddie KennisonWR197319962008001269179000000103928205254883454290
41Ko KieftTE19982022202400114600882219
42Terry KirbyRB1970199320020024711046853310007612875273833332221282
43Rich KraynakLB196119831987000661000
44Cameron LawrenceLB199120132014000227000
45Reggie LewisDE195419821984000534000
46Rian LindellK19772000201300031212000
47Kevin LongRB195519771981001227305742190252774539327
48James LynchDL199920202024000550000
49Frank MattiaceDE-NT19611987198700003000
50Rey MaualugaLB19872009201700949120000
51Tony McDanielDT19852006201700328146000
52George McDuffieDE19631987198700013000
53Wally McIlwainWB19031926192600105000
54Johnny MitchellTE19711992199600217570015921031665
55Anthony MixWR1983200720070000900339021
56Ed MuranskyT196019821984000224000
57Michael MyersDT-DE19761998200700334138000
58DeVante ParkerWR199320152023006361190040256602756
59Tab PerryWR19822005200700012006221910109130
60Jim PetersonLB1950197419760001131000
61Bryan PittmanC1977200320090001199000
62Milt PlumQB1935195719690275312913062419175361229212711617112175311345120020
63Alan PringleK19521975197500001000
64Jeb PutzierTE197920022008001126900961251339
65Gene RobertsHB-FB192319471950013044010001499190414636411351285
66Tom RodgersT19231947194700009000
67Tom RousselLB1945196819730021566000
68Chapelle RussellLB199720202021000227000
69Benny SappDB19812004201100013110000
70Wendell SmallwoodRB1994201620210011056023895652660474236
71Paul StarobaWR1949197219730000100111011242123
72Mark StepnoskiC-G196719892001051280194010000
73Dadrion Taylor-DemersonDB200120242024000013000
74Tedric ThompsonSS199520172021002938000
75O'Cyrus TorrenceOL200020232024002830000
76Curtis TownsendLB19551978197800039000
77Jeremiah TrotterLB19771998200914971147000
78Tuufuli UperesaG19481971197100012000
79Lawrence VirgilNT19912014201400001000
80Clint WagerE192019421945000023007116038
81Sammy WalkerDB196919911993000426000
82Bert WeidnerG-C1966199019950022681000
83Hal WendlerBB19021926192600008000
84Keion WhiteDL199920232024001329000
85Pooh Bear WilliamsRB19751998199800003025030
86John WoodDT19511973197300012000
87Elmer WynneFB190119281929001015000
88Ray YakavonisNT195719811983000121000